Costello Music by The Fratellis:
I don't know how I missed the debut album from this Scottish rock band, especially since Chelsea Dagger was one of my jams in 2011. Each song is a catchy, high energy germ with a little storytelling woven in.

Final Grade: B+

How to Destroy a Tech Startup in Three Easy Steps by Lawrence Krubner and Natalie Sidner:
First up in my self-quarantine reading queue, this book tells of a lead developer's experience at a NYC startup. Like Dan Lyon's Disrupted: My Misadventure in the Start-Up Bubble (which I gave a B), Krubner paints a great picture of toxic management and software development personalities which will feel exaggerated until you stumble across that one you've actually encountered yourself in the wild. Tech jargon is kept to a minimum and well-explained for non-developers, and software developers may experience a sympathetic rise in blood pressure during some of the more true-to-life scenes.

Final Grade: B+

Better Call Saul, Season Four:
This season was very "good" in the way that "good" is understood by cinephiles, but it did not noticeably move the story far beyond what had already come before. The entire thing felt a little low energy and sometimes Jimmy McGill seemed like a B-story in his own show. The backstory behind Gustavo Fring's empire is still the most boring part to me -- I would rather see more of Jimmy's exploits than spend 8 episodes digging a hole in the ground. Free on Netflix.

Final Grade: B-

Lady Bird (R):
This was a perfectly pleasant coming-of-age story that didn't really stick with me after it was over. With snappy dialogue and believable characters, it's a good movie for nights when nothing else is on. Free on Amazon Prime.

Final Grade: B
